Cold laser treatment is a helpful device to aid hurting administration and the healing process. It is frequently used in sporting activities medicine, dermatology and acupuncture.


Cold lasers pass through deep into tissues and advertise chemical changes without heating them. They minimize swelling and swelling, speed up mobile activity and accelerate recovery.

Theoretical History
Unlike the high-intensity lasers that surgeons use to puncture tissue, cold laser therapy utilizes light-emitting diodes to pass through right into your skin and advertise recovery. As these photons get to damaged tissues, they initiate a chain reaction that boosts your cells' manufacturing of enzymes and increases your body's all-natural recovery processes.

The photons additionally minimize discomfort with the manufacturing of endorphins and increase your body's ability to drain swollen areas by inducing vasodilation (the expansion of blood vessels). Because of this, it aids you recover from musculoskeletal injuries and discomfort quicker.

Cold laser treatment is typically recommended as a therapy choice for patients that have musculoskeletal discomfort and injuries. It can be used to minimize inflammation, reinforce tissues and increase the body's natural healing processes.

Non-thermal photons of red and infrared laser radiation are taken in by the light delicate components in cells and initiate a boost in intracellular metabolism that boosts cell reproduction, minimizes inflammation, removes edema and reduces healing time.

Unlike the light that is generated by sunlight or typical lights, laser light is parallel (all wavelengths traveling in the same direction), systematic and monochromatic. These residential properties allow laser power to penetrate much deeper into the tissues.

Numerous clinical tests have revealed that LLLT can be reliable in decreasing pain in the bone and joint system. Nevertheless, even more properly designed studies are needed to evaluate the optimum settings for laser irradiation and to determine its performance in details problems, such as dental mucositis in cancer cells patients receiving chemotherapy or radiotherapy, and injury healing (consisting of diabetic person abscess following hammertoe surgical procedure). Unlike surgical lasers that can ruin lumps or coagulate tissue, chilly laser treatment does not heat up the body's cells. Rather, the light promotes your cells to create adenosine triphosphate, which accelerates the repair procedure of injured tissues.

Aetna considers low-level laser (LLL) treatment clinically needed for the avoidance of oral mucositis connected with cancer treatment (chemotherapy, radiation treatment, hematopoietic stem cell transplant) and non-cancer treatments (such as radiodermal injury, fibromyalgia). Several studies showed that LLT can be reliable in decreasing PU signs without damaging results. However, distinctions mls laser therapy near me in research layouts and laser dosimetry made contrast of the results difficult; RCTs with reduced danger of prejudice are required. Making use of a 660 nm wavelength and greater energy density seems extra reliable than the various other researched laser wavelengths. This could be due to the fact that the various other wavelengths might boost inflammatory procedures and create even more side effects. The result of the type of laser made use of is additionally important; the authors recommend that future research concentrate on reviewing various sorts of lasers and their dosages to figure out the ideal combination of laser parameters for PU prevention.

Cold laser treatment is utilized by dental practitioners to deal with irritated gum tissue, medical professionals to reduce discomfort triggered by rheumatoid arthritis, and physical therapists to speed the healing of muscular tissue, ligament, and tendon injuries. Several clinical insurance coverage plans cover this therapy.

Unlike warm lasers, which have a thermal result on cells, cool lasers (additionally called low-level lasers) promote the cellular power of the skin. Photons from the laser light permeate into the cell, triggering a collection of chemical adjustments that promotes regrowth and minimizes inflammation.

In order to be effective, lasers should be correctly arrangement and utilized. This is why it is not recommended to buy a low-cost over-the-counter laser tool and attempt to treat yourself in the house. A skilled specialist is required to ensure that the tool is utilized correctly to lessen the risk of eye injury and optimize its efficiency. The laser tool should be adjusted to the right setting, strength, frequency, and placement of the laser on the treatment location.
